The government is proposing major changes to the Island’s universal benefits system.
Social Care Minister Chris Robertshaw says there’ll be a series of consultations on the changes to social care policy over the summer.
The changes, according to Mr Robertshaw, will mean more emphasis on the truly needy – with less support for people considered to be self-sufficient or well-off.
